— An intensive program for students and early-career professionals envisioning the future of fusion power —

The Fusion Industry Research Center, Keio University (Location: Kohoku-ku, Yokohama | Director: Shutaro Takeda) is pleased to announce that it has been selected for the FY2025 National Institute for Fusion Science (NIFS) Schooling & Networking Program (Fusion Science School).

Centered around the newly established Fusion Industry Research Center, Keio University will host an intensive three-day program titled “How to Build a Fusion Power Plant: Three Days to Design the Future [feat. J-Fusion]”, to be held from Friday, January 30 to Sunday, February 1, 2026, in co-organization with the Japan Fusion Energy Council (J-Fusion).

This program provides a multifaceted learning experience on the social implementation of fusion energy, bringing together perspectives from science, engineering, industry, policy, and society to explore the future of energy systems.
